I think he's willy overrated, but honestly, very few artists could live up to the praise heaped upon him. I think the only other post-60s artist that has been so constantly lauded is Kanye West.

That said, he puts on a fantastic live show, he's one of the few guys from his era who isn't just mailing it in for a paycheck, and Born to Run, while overplayed as hell, is an unimpeachable classic album. It's the Pearl Jam Ten of the 70s. A great album that requires you to avoid pop culture so you can enjoy it again. There's a REASON it got overplayed.

I do prefer Mellencamp, which is like telling a Bruce fan you prefer rat poison to filet mignon.

Still, he is a legit great who might be so overrated he's now underrated. Hes the Derek Jeter of rock music.

I vehemently disagree with his politics but there's absolutely no denying that he's one of the best all time performers. I think that his peak was The River tour in 1980. I saw him in Phoenix that year and it was a balls to the wall 5 1/2 hour set. Even now at 64, he blows away people half his age. He's always willing to reinvent himself and his music and if you see him constantly, his shows are always different. The funny thing about the haters who say, "Bruce sucks, so and so is better...most of those "so and sos" are huge Bruce fans.
